I've looked up the word "muntin(s)" in many dictionaries but I didn't find it. What does it mean?

I agree with Peachey. Muntins are strips of wood (or metal) which separate the panes in a window composed of several panes. Usually they are vertical and in this case they are also called "mullions". In Italian they are known as "montanti fissi di separazione".
